Web performance is nothing but the speed in which web pages are downloaded and displayed on the user’s web browser. Faster website speeds have been shown to increase sales or increase visitor loyalty including user satisfaction. Particularly useful for those use slow internet connections or on mobile phones/tablets.

In short, one can increase the time it takes for pages to render using multi-layered cache and asynchronous communication with server-side components.
